| 2 | packages | spinach | chopped, frozen |
| 4 | tablespoons | butter | |
| 2 | tablespoons | flour, all-purpose | |
| 2 | tablespoons | onion | chopped |
| 1/2 | cup | evaporated milk | |
| 1/2 | cup | liqueur | veg. |
| 1/2 | teaspoon | black pepper | |
| 3/4 | teaspoon | celery salt | |
| 3/4 | teaspoon | garlic salt | |
| 1 | x | salt | to taste |
| 6 | ounces | jalapeno cheese | roll |
| 1 | teaspoon | worcestershire sauce | |
| 1 | x | cayenne pepper | to taste |
Cook spinach according to directions on package.
Drain and reserve liqueur.
Melt butter.
Add flour-stir to blended and smooth, but not brown.
Add onion to cook until soft but not brown.
Add liqueur slowly stirring constantly.
Cook until smooth and thick.
Add seasoning and cheese, cut into small pieces.
Stir until melted.
Combine with cooked spinach.
May put in casserole with buttered bread crumbs.
